
Vladislav Ryzhikov
Lecturer
I joined Birkbeck in September 2017 in my current role. From 2011 to 2017 I was an assistant professor (fixed term) at the KRDB Research Centre, Faculty of Computer Science, Free University of Bozen-Bolzano, Italy. I received PhD in 2010 with the thesis on temporal description logics and conceptual modelling.

Research
Areas of interest: Knowledge representation and reasoning, temporal and spatial data, temporal logics, semantic web, description logics, conceptual modelling
